Leadership Workshop

On Thursday, our Year 5 & Year 6 students will participate in a leadership workshop with presenters from Unleashing Personal Potential’ (UPP). The workshop we are doing is called Positive Peer Relationships. This is some information from their website. 

Positive Peer Relationships is about building personal and social skills to enhance the quantity and quality of our interpersonal interactions.

Positive Peer Relationships has two distinct sessions that each run for approximately 90-120 minutes. The two sessions are GROWING MY SOCIAL SKILLS and BUILDING STRONGER RELATIONSHIPS. They are delivered at your school in a single day by Unleashing Personal Potential, to whole year level cohorts. 

SKILLS DEVELOPED AND CONCEPTS COVERED:  

  • THE POWER OF EMPATHY- focussing on standing as one, respect and appreciating differences.
  • BULLYING & THE SCIENCE OF KINDNESS- learning about the potential impacts of bullying and kindness, on others and on ourselves.
  • ACTIVE LISTENING- practical skills for strengthening relationships.
  • CONFLICT RESOLUTION- learning how to be assertive, rather than passive or aggressive.
  • FORGIVENESS VS HOLDING A GRUDGE- "Forgive others not because they deserve forgiveness, but because you deserve peace".
  • TEAM WORK- Working collaboratively in teams to achieve more. Structured opportunities to apply what has been learned.
  • RISING BY LIFTING OTHERS- Learning how to give a genuine shout out.
